The brief

Media coverage is currently focused on the integration of artificial intelligence into the lives of children. Discussions highlight both the promise and the peril of these technologies as they reshape traditional childhood experiences.

Outlets including Planet Money, Time Magazine, Axios, The Street, and HuffPost UK are reporting on these developments. These reports emphasize concerns regarding the loss of basic skills, the role of human attention as a digital divide, and the specific ways boys interact with AI platforms.

Future developments remain dependent on how educators and parents address the shifting technological landscape. Coverage does not yet specify long-term outcomes or regulatory responses to these observed trends.
